Handover: QuotaKeeper, per-tenant rate quotas

From Delia to Arvid. QuotaKeeper enforces per-tenant request quotas at the Lanthorn gateway. Burst allowances are per tenant tier; hard caps are global. Known gap: quota checks are skipped on the internal admin path — flagged for your review. Audit logging of quota denials is enabled and retained 90 days. No shared secrets in the quota layer itself. Current enforcement configuration follows.

settings of tagag-kawep:
OLIAEL_HOST=oliael.zemvarsys.internal
OLIAEL_PORT=5672

Welcome to on-call for the Glimmerpane design system! Our snapshot tests live in the `snapcheck` suite and run on every merge to main. If a UI component changes visually, the diff bot flags it — usually it's an intentional tweak, so just approve the new baseline. If it's 2am and snapshots are failing across the board, it's almost always a font-loading race, not your problem. To unlock the baseline store and re-approve snapshots in bulk, use the recovery passphrase below.

recovery phrase for tahag-taguf: wenix-caswyn

Subject: Quickstore 4.2 — bloom filter now fronts the KV layer

Plugin authors: starting with this release, Quickstore places a bloom filter ahead of the key-value store. Negative lookups return faster; false positives fall through safely. No API changes are required on your side. Verify your plugin against the staging build referenced below.

session token of fahif-tadup = htk3_9c7

Subject: DR drill — Fieldmark offline mode, plugin impact

Hello plugin authors,

Next Thursday we will run a disaster-recovery drill for Fieldmark's offline mode. During the drill, sync endpoints will be unavailable for roughly two hours; plugins should queue writes locally as documented. Plugins that register background jobs must handle the restart signal gracefully. To access the drill sandbox and test your recovery hooks, use the sandbox passphrase:

vault phrase of bagaf-kajeg = jorath-feniel-briir-siliel-ralix